Credit-crunch Comparison!

In the first week of July we priced up the contents of our £3 vegebox with similar organic produce from Sainsbury's and Waitrose (except Waitrose only had non-organic peppers)

We were flabbergasted to discover that were you to buy the contents of Goosemoor's £3 vegebox from either of these supermarkets, it would cost you over 70% more!  Another way of looking at it, if you already buy from supermarkets, is that you can save over 40% by buying from Goosemoor!  

So why spend £5.20 when you can get the same for just £3?  And you'll also be supporting a local business which has ethics and care for the environment at its core

Approx Qty UNIT PRODUCT  GOOSE SAINSBURY WAITROSE
1 kg POTATO   £1.00 £1.16
0.5 kg CARROT   £0.80 £0.95
0.3 kg COURGETTE   £1.20 £1.10
1 # CABBAGE Spring Greens 350g   £1.50 £1.49
1 # PEPPER Green   £0.70 £0.59 not organic
       
    Total Price

£3.00

£5.20 £5.29
    Supermarkets cost you more by:   73% 76%
    Goosemoor saves you:   42% 43%

What's local or home-grown in July?

The range of local crops increases every week at this time of year, but there's still a little more time to wait for local carrots (although we have some lovely new carrots from Wales at the moment).....

  • Potatoes
  • Broad beans
  • Beetroot, bunched
  • Onions, bunched
  • Celery
  • Kohl Rabi
  • Spring Greens
  • Summer Cabbage
  • Herbs
  • Pak Choi
  • Spinach
  • Lettuce
  • Cucumber

Other UK produce available:

  • Beansprouts
  • Broccoli
  • Carrot
  • Cauliflower
  • Tomatoes, cherry, plum, round, all both on and off the vine
  • Mushrooms
  • Watercress

What’s Growing this month?

Pea in flowerThe pea plants are sending their tendrils racing up the supports, and setting plenty of pods, but they need time for the peas inside to swell, and it's easy to be impatient and pick them too early!

Basil growing in a tunnelThe herbs are soaking up the hot sunshine, particularly the basil and parsley, although the basil will soon start to reduce leaf production as it begins to flower.  Parsley being a biennial, doesn't flower at all until its second year, and so produces leaf all through its first year

Cucumbers are cropping well, but the chillis will take a couple of weeks longer to get into their stride.  We're growing 3 varieties this year: Hungarian Hot Wax (mild), Jalapeno (hot) and Ring of Fire (hottest!) - you have been warned!
